﻿    .fixIconBtnsIpadScroll{display:none;}
    .fixIconBtns
    {
        position: absolute;
        left: 1.1%;
        background: #5f5f5f;
        top: 60.9%;
        z-index: 999;
        width: 32px;
        pointer-events: none;
        height: 28px;
    }
    .owl-next:hover{height: 84px !important;top: 9px !important;}
    .owl-prev:hover,.owl-next:hover {
    background-color: #5f5f5f !important;
    }
    .owl-carousel .owl-wrapper-outer
    {
        position: relative;
        right: -1px;
    }
    .detailed_page_photoalbum {
padding: 0.6em;
cursor: pointer;
padding-left: 5px;
padding-right: 5px;
}
    .row_detailed_page .owl-next {
        right: -6.5% !important;
    }
    .row_detailed_page .owl-prev {left: -5.9% !important;}
    
    
     #detailed_page_photoalbum_more
    {
        padding-top: 5px;
        left: -2.5%;
        width: 105%;
    }
    .active_thumb>img {
    border-color: #E5C069;
    width: 96%;
    margin-top: 2px;
    }
    
     .owl-buttons
    {margin-top: -15px;}
     .row_detailed_page .owl-next
    {height: 85px;top: 6%;}
     .row_detailed_page .owl-prev{top: 6%;height: 85px;background-position: -10px 16px !important;}
     .dark.dark_fix.full.page-section.m-all.m-pad.t-all.t-pad.d-all.d-pad
    {border-bottom: none;}
    #ipadwidth .owl-carousel {
        
        width: 108% !important;
        right: -23px;
    }
    .fixIconBtnsIpad
    {display:none;}
    @media only screen and (width: 1280px)
    {
         .dark.dark_fix.full.page-section.m-all.m-pad.t-all.t-pad.d-all.d-pad
        {
            width: 99.4% !important;
        }
    }
        @media only screen and (width: 1024px)
    {
         .owl-carousel {
        
        width: 100% !important;
        right: 0px;
    }
         .dark.dark_fix.full.page-section.m-all.m-pad.t-all.t-pad.d-all.d-pad
        {
            width: 98.4% !important;
        }
        
         #detailed_page_photoalbum_more {
            left: -3%;
            width: 106.1%;
        }
         .row_detailed_page
        {
            position: relative;
            right: 6px;
        }
         .owl-theme .owl-controls .owl-buttons div.owl-prev
        {
            position: absolute;
            left: -37px !important;
            background-size: 35px !important;
            width: 0px;
            height: 60px;
            background-position: -7px 17px !important;
            top: 8px;
        }
        .owl-theme .owl-controls .owl-buttons div.owl-next
        {
            position: absolute;
background-size: 35px !important;
right: -50px !important;
width: 0px;
height: 61px !important;
background-position: -7px 18px !important;
top: 8px !important;
        }
        .detailed_page_photoalbum {
        padding: 0.6em;
        cursor: pointer;
        padding-left:0px;
        margin-left: 10px;
        padding-right: 0px;
}
.fixIconBtns {
position: absolute;
left: -23px;
background: #5f5f5f;
top: 60px;
z-index: 999;
width: 20px;
pointer-events: none;
height: 19px;
}
    .fixIconBtnsIpad
    {display:block;
     width: 20px;
height: 14px;
background: #5f5f5f;
position: absolute;
right: -36px;
top: 13px;
z-index: 9999;
pointer-events: none;
     }
     .owl-carousel .owl-wrapper-outer
     {
         
        right: 0px;
     }
     
     .dark_fix>figure{min-height: 395px;}
    .fixIconBtnsIpadScroll
    {
        display:block;
        position: absolute;
        left: 5px;
        background: #4c4c4c;
        top: 10px;
        z-index: 999;
        width: 10px;
        pointer-events: none;
        height: 70px;
    }
    }
    @media only screen and (width: 768px)
    {
          #detailed_page_photoalbum_more {
            left: -4% !important;
            width: 108% !important;
        }
         .dark.dark_fix.full.page-section.m-all.m-pad.t-all.t-pad.d-all.d-pad
        {
            left: -2px;
            width: 95.3% !important;
        }
         .dark_fix>figure
        {
            min-height: 300px;
        }
        .fixIconBtns,.fixIconBtnsIpad{display:none;}
        #ipadwidth
        {   position: relative;
            right: 9px;}
    }
        @media only screen and (max-width: 767px)
        {
             .dark_fix>figure
        {
            min-height: 200px !important;
        }
        .fixIconBtns,.fixIconBtnsIpad{display:none;}
        #ipadwidth
        {   position: relative;
            right: 11px;}
        }
        